Output 8898e26fda555b5c92343a4909e5e114214e8b19e345cdb18c793e833009a2fe:1

value
8520000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d36b1d789f01c7b290e419503e3127ca1c2e5530 OP_EQUALVERIFY OP_CHECKSIG
address
1LGstxzTTURUd4BBg8ALxuodhg8mjhiyVy
transaction
8898e26fda555b5c92343a4909e5e114214e8b19e345cdb18c793e833009a2fe
spent
true